CCHIT Urges Private-Public Partnership to Govern the NwHIN

Manos, Diana. "CCHIT Urges Private-Public Partnership to Govern the NwHIN." Healthcare IT News, June 27, 2012. 

From the article: "The Certification Commission for Health Information Technology (CCHIT) believes a private-public partnership would be better to run the future Nationwide Health Information Network (NwHIN), rather than a federal body alone.

According to Karen Bell, MD, chair of CCHIT and former director of the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ology (ONC), Office of Health Information Technology Adoption, governance of the NwHIN would need stakeholders from all angles of the project, including public health officials, providers, consumers and even third party users outside of the federal government."
